Weather & Seasons at Burton Wells Complex
- Winter: Winter days are generally mild and pleasant, with average temperatures in the mid-50s to low-60s Fahrenheit. Evenings can be cool, often dropping into the 40s. Visitors should pack layers, including sweaters, light jackets, and perhaps a scarf for cooler mornings or evenings. Outdoor play is usually comfortable, but sudden fronts can bring crisp air, making a light waterproof jacket useful.
- Spring & early summer: Spring sees temperatures warming from the 60s into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, with increasing humidity. Early summer brings hotter conditions, often reaching the high 80s and low 90s, with high humidity. Light, breathable clothing is essential. S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are must-haves for protection, especially during midday events.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is characterized by significant heat and humidity, with daytime temperatures consistently in the 90s Fahrenheit, often feeling hotter due to humidity. Afternoon thunderstorms are common and can cause delays. Visitors must prioritize staying hydrated, using cooling towels, and seeking shade whenever possible. Lightweight, moisture-wicking apparel is highly recommended.
- Fall season: Fall offers a transition to cooler, more comfortable weather, with temperatures gradually decreasing from the 80s in early autumn to the 60s by late fall. Humidity also lessens. This season is excellent for outdoor activities, and packing layers such as light jackets or long-sleeved shirts is advisable for cooler mornings and evenings.
- Rain & snow: Rainfall is possible year-round, with thunderstorms being particularly common in summer afternoons. Light, packable rain gear is recommended. Snow is extremely rare in this region, with winter precipitation usually manifesting as cold rain. Always check the forecast before heading to the complex, as heavy rain can lead to event delays or cancellations.
